The Case Logic RBP-414 Intransit 14" Laptop Daypack is a slim, lightweight backpack designed for professionals with up to 14-inch laptops. It features a thickly padded laptop compartment, a dedicated tablet sleeve, and seven zippered pockets for superior organization. Comfort-focused with padded straps and back panel, it also includes a hidden lumbar security pocket and reflective materials for safe commuting. Side pockets accommodate water bottles or chargers, making it the perfect compact companion for urban commuters who value style, security, and efficiency.

Perfect, Slim laptop backpack
This is a great slim 14 inch Laptop bag similar to prior model 114 with good improvements over the older that is still sold (I had prior model for 4 years until it was killed in washing machine accident with the straps [older model is $9 dollars cheaper as of this writing]). The 414 is a really nice bag with the following features, not all necessarily advertised: *Comfortable fit and adjustable straps with velcro fasteners to keep excess length in the straps tidy after adjustment. *Besides main 2 compartments most laptop bags have; there are 7 zippered compartments to keep your stuff organized and readily available. *Main 2 zippered compartment only go 1/2 down bag length, this keeps the bag from flopping open and helps keep stuff in these compartment from flying out. You would be surprised how many bags do not do this. *Main compartment of course has padded laptop sleeve section. *There are of course dedicated slots for phones, pens, keychain loop and such. *It is the smaller inside zippered compartments that are key for me. They keep you organized and further keep smaller items from falling out of bag or being difficult to find. * 3/7 of auxiliary zippered pockets are inside main sections. * 1/7 of auxiliary zippered pockets is at the top of the bag for ready access * 1/7 of padded auxiliary zippered pockets is hidden from view at the back of the bag to put a wallet/Phone or other valuables out of pickpocket access since you can't get to it without the bag being removed from your body. * 2/7 Side auxiliary zippered pockets and 2 water bottle holders (have not tried these yet). Real world size info: I find this bag spacious for a small slim bag (I routinely have my 13 Inch Retina mac, wallet, cell, keys, 1/2 dozen memory sticks, cycling gloves (and at least until i get to work my breakfast and lunch in zip-locks). If it’s raining I can shove my thin lightweight windbreaker in there too. I'm a 40 Long and 185 pounds and found the bags size perfect. I barely had to adjust the strap length but there is plenty more for bigger people. Very Pleased again. For those considering the older model, it does not have the security pocket, has only 2 auxiliary zippered compartments inside main and no side pockets/water holders. If older model had been in stock I probably would have just re-ordered it:) Happier still now with the new version/model 414. ***FYI about Laptop bags as I read comments form some surprised that this bag was not really large: Most people buying a slim/small laptop bags do so on purpose: *It keeps things neat. *It keeps you from bumping into your fellow commuters if you take mass transit or other tight spaces. *Keeps you from overpacking and hurting your back and making clutter. *Laptop bags meant for 13-14 inch laptops are almost always going to be slim and small and not able to hold much more then the laptop, charger, wallet, phone and other small stuff. Best described as **Slim/small. *Bags that hold up to 15.6 Inch Laptops hold much more gear besides the laptop and are best described as Medium sized. *Bags that hold 17 inch Laptops hold a lot of gear and are best described as Large.

Great backpack, can be a bit uncomfortable when heavy and carried for a while
I’ve had this bag for more than two years now and use it when I travel. I usually stuff it with a couple laptops, wireless headphones, power packs, chargers (at least one, but most of the time two), a jacket and some snacks. It holds up well to all the abuse I throw at it - i usually put it under the seat in front of me (for quick access) and rest my feet on top of it, yet it protects my laptop and other electronics from damage. However, it can sometimes get annoying to carry on the back as I start feeling pain around the back of my neck (mostly lower part of the neck where it meets the back). I love the handle at the bottom which makes it easier to pull out of the overhead compartment (in the rare cases I put it there with the top towards the inner walls) Other than that, great backpack - well priced and fits a lot of stuff for its size.

Great for my purposes!
This is a fantastic bag! Small and compact with a good amount of pockets! It is perfect for my needs as I am a student gone digital. This is a great backpack for those who pack some school essentials while tossing the textbooks goodbye and go digital instead. The back of the backpack is very comfortable and well padded! The bottom padded part has a secret pocket too! Straps are good although it could use just a bit more padding. Everything else about this backpack is great!!! Fantastic for what my needs are! It can fit in my glasses, pencils and pens, erasers, highlighters, cables, power banks, flash drives, graphing and scientific calculators with the case on the graphing one, headphones with the case, fully stuffed one inch binder, water bottles on the sides, amazon kindle, and my 10.1 inch screen Asus laptop! Once again if your a student who plans to go digital and wants a smaller form factor of a backpack then by all means get this one! It's great! The only downside I can say is that the outside material doesn't really look and feel like the waterproof kind and if you are anywhere over 5 feet 1-2 inches tall then it may look very small on you to the point of embarrassment. *IMPORTANT NOTE* - The 4th, 5th, and 7th picture shown from Amazon before I bought this backpack is slightly misleading as it shows this backpack having a band on the back used to help put the bag on those suitcase luggage carrier handles. Mine does not have it and I don't believe I got a defect. I checked this same backpack from the Case Logic website and looked at this exact model name and the pictures show the one I got without the band on the back! Also the one on the Amazon pictures had smaller back support pads on the back at the sides while the one from Case Logic and mines has bigger pads and by bigger I mean more vertical.
